Fairmont State, UC favorites in MEC softball poll

1 min read

BRIDGEPORT -- Fairmont State University and the University of Charleston have been selected as the divisional favorites for the upcoming Mountain East Conference softball season, the league announced Thursday afternoon.

Fairmont State led the north divisional poll with nine first place votes.

Additionally in the north, West Liberty picked up two first-place votes. The Hilltoppers were followed by Point Park, Wheeling and Frostburg State in the divisional poll.

After winning their third straight MEC Championship, Charleston was selected as the south divisional favorite, collecting six first place votes. The Golden Eagles concluded the 2025 season at the NCAA Atlantic Regionals.

Glenville State earned four first-place votes in the south divisional poll, respectively, followed by Davis & Elkins, West Virginia Wesleyan, which had a first- place vote, Concord, and West Virginia State rounded out the poll.

The 2026 MEC Softball Preseason Poll was voted on by the league's head coaches. Coaches were not permitted to vote for their own teams.
